Tecmo Koei revenues fall 14%

Merged company's results disappoint as key titles fail to impress

Tecmo Koei has reported its full year financial results noting revenues that were down almost 14 per cent over the previous year - despite the two companies having merged last year.

In total the publisher reported revenues of ¥34.5 billion ($386 million), while net income was down 7 per cent to ¥2.6 billion ($29 million).

Sales of its major titles weren't strong, with big hope Ninja Gaiden Sigma 2 only selling less than half a million units, while the delay of other key games - as indicated in the company's Q3 results - also hit income.

However, profit was up somewhat on previous estimates of ¥2 billion ($22 million), which helped the company's share price to hold steady at ¥664 ($7.41) when the Tokyo Stock Exchanged closed today.
